Meeks, Clarence “Slim”

Clarence “Slim” M. Meeks , 88, Farwell died Thursday, April 6, 2006, at Farwell Convalescent Center.

He was born April 4, 1918, in Farwell, Texas to Edward H. and Nannie Avo Meeks.

He graduated from Oklahoma Lane High School in 1935. He spent five years in World War II in the 3rd Armored Division of the U.S. Army. He married Addie (Snooks) Birchfield on Jan. 17, 1948, in Clovis. He was a lifelong farmer, retiring at the age of 62.

He was a member of the Farwell Church of Christ serving as a deacon and elder for 50 plus years.

He was preceded in death by his parents; his wife; three brothers and a granddaughter.

He is survived by two daughters, Debbie Sewell (and husband, J.R.) of Seminole, Texas, and Susan Scioli (Doug) of Texico; five grandchildren; seven great-grandchildren; four sisters-in-law and numerous nieces and nephews.
